Seattle Queer History Bike Tour @ Volunteer Park | Seattle | Washington | United States

In partnership with Cascade Bicycle Club, Certified Ride Leader and Historian Bob Svercl will lead a group of riders on a 5.6 mile bike tour from Capitol Hill through Pioneer Square to MoPOP, stopping at historic and iconic sites around Seattle while hearing stories and learning about Seattle’s LGBTQIA+ history. Meet at Volunteer Park from noon to 1 p.m. for bike decorating and pre-ride socializing. At 1:00 p.m., we will gather and head out on a rain or shine, no-drop, casual bike and e-bike friendly ride that will wrap up at the MoPOP plaza with trivia and prizes.
